Three-body recombination near a narrow Feshbach resonance in $^6$Li

arXiv:1801.06489 · doi:10.1103/PhysRevLett.120.193402

Abstract

We experimentally measure, and theoretically analyze the three-atom recombination rate, $L_3$, around a narrow $s$ wave magnetic Feshbach resonance of $^6$Li-$^6$Li at 543.3 Gauss. By examining both the magnetic field dependence and especially the temperature dependence of $L_3$ over a wide range of temperatures from a few $μ$K to above 200 $μ$K, we show that three-atom recombination through a narrow resonance follows a universal behavior determined by the long-range van der Waals potential, and can be described by a set of rate equations in which three-body recombination proceeds via successive pairwise interactions. We expect the underlying physical picture to be applicable not only to narrow $s$ wave resonances, but also to resonances in nonzero partial waves, and not only at ultracold temperatures, but also at much higher temperatures.
